Will wrote:

Hooked up the N64 earlier this week and played some Goldeneye for the first time in over 10 years. It still rocks smile I'm upto Bunker 2 on 00 Agent mode already, and have unlocked some of the harder cheats like Invincibility (Facility, 00Agent, 2:05) and Invisibility (Archives, 00Agent, 1:20). Had a ragequit not long ago as Bunker 2 is kicking my ass, so come online to bitch about it and watch some youtube vids for tips.

Also just bought Perfect Dark on eBay (the spiritual successor to Goldeneye). Aint played that in years either so will have to find time to play through that big_smile

On the N64 my favourite racing games were Wave Race and F-Zero X. I had the Japanese import of F-Zero as I just couldn't wait to play it, think I paid about £85 for it which was a lot for me at 15/16 and only working a Satuday job at £10 a day. The import cart ran through a convertor making it ~17% faster than the eventual UK PAL release so it was crazy fast and worth every penny.
